body{margin:1% 3%;background:black;color:#3F3F3F;font-family: "Comic Sans MS", "Sand CE", fantasy;}
/*==================================================================*/
hr.cleaner {clear:both;width:100%;height:1px;margin:-1px 0 -1px 0;padding:0;visibility: hidden;_display:none;}
h1, h2, h3, h4, h5, h6, p, a{margin:0;border:0;padding:0;}
form{margin:0;}
img{border:none;}
h1{background:transparent;color:#CC3300;font-size:1.7em;}
h2{background:transparent;color:#CC3300;font-size:1.7em;}
acronym{border-bottom:dashed 1px;cursor:help;}
/*=Jednotný top pro celý web (bude doplněno o přepínání na detailu)=*/
#header{width:100%;height:90px;background:url(images/2bg-header-new.jpg) top left no-repeat;border-top:2px solid #E8E8E8;}
#header-left{width:30%;float:left;}
#header-left-content{width:auto;height:90px;padding:0.3em 0 0 0.7em;border-left:2px solid #E8E8E8;background:transparent;color:white;}
#header-right{width:70%;float:right;}
#header-right-content{width:auto;height:90px;padding:0.3em 0.7em 0 0;text-align:right;}
#header h2{font-size:2.4em;background:transparent;color:white;visibility:hidden;padding-top:0.4em;}
#header span{background:transparent;color:white;visibility:hidden;}
#header a{text-decoration:none;}
#header p{font-size:0.9em;}
#header img{border:1px solid black;}
/*=Topnavigace pro detail==================================*/
#a{width:100%;background:white;border-top:1px solid black;}
#a-left{width:70%;float:left;}
#a-left-content{width:auto;padding:0.1em 0 0 0.7em;}
#a-left-content p{display:inline;padding:0 0 0 0.7em;}
#a-left-content a{text-decoration:none;}
#a-right{width:30%;float:right;}
#a-right-content{width:auto;}
#a-right-content{text-align:right;padding:0 0.7em 0 0;}
#a-right-content input{margin:0.1em 0 0.1em 0.7em;}
/*=Topnavigace pro pro zbytek==============================*/
#am{width:100%;background:white;border-top:1px solid black;}
#am-left{width:70%;float:left;}
#am-left-content{width:auto;padding:0.1em 0 0 0.7em;}
#am-left-content p{display:inline;padding:0 0 0 0.7em;}
#am-left-content a{text-decoration:none;}
#am-right{width:25%;float:right;}
#am-right-content{width:auto;}
#am-right-content{text-align:right;padding:0 0.7em 0 0;}
#am-right-content input{margin:0.1em 0 0.1em 0.7em;}
/*=Tělo detailu=======================================================*/
#b{width:100%;background:#f5deb3;border-top:1px solid black;font-size:0.8em;}
#b-left{width:63%;float:left;background:url(images/bg-detail.jpg) top right no-repeat;color:inherit;}
#b-left-content{width:auto;margin:0.7em 0.7em 0.7em 0.7em;padding:0.7em 0.7em 0.7em 0.7em;text-align:left;}
#b-right{width:32%;float:right;}
#b-right-content{width:auto;margin:0.7em 0.7em 0.7em 0.7em;text-align:center;}
#b img{border:none;}
#b h3{background:transparent;color:blue;font-size:1.1em;}
#b h4{font-size:1em;}
#otviracka{text-align:center;}
td.cas{text-align:left;}
td.hodina{text-align:right;}
.chyba{background:transparent;color:red;}
.ok{background:transparent;color:green;}
.výstraha{background:transparent;color:red;}
.pocet-pripominek{font-size:xx-small;}
/*=Formuláře na detailu===============================================*/
#c{width:100%;background:#f5deb3;border-top:1px solid black;}
#c-left{width:100%;float:left;}
#c-left-content{width:auto;margin:0.7em 0.7em 0.7em 0.7em;border-left:1px solid black;padding:0.7em 0.7em 0.7em 0.7em;text-align:center;}
/*=Bottom navigace pro detail================================================*/
#d{width:100%;background:white;border-top:1px solid black;}
#d-left{width:96%;float:left;}
#d-left-content{width:auto;padding:0.1em 0 0 0.7em;}
#d-left-content p{display:inline;padding:0 0 0 0.7em;}
#d-left-content a{text-decoration:none;}
/*=Bottom navigace pro zbytek=====================================*/
#dm{width:100%;background:white;border-top:1px solid black;}
#dm-left{width:96%;float:left;}
#dm-left-content{width:auto;padding:0.1em 0 0 0.7em;}
#dm-left-content p{display:inline;padding:0 0 0 0.7em;}
#dm-left-content a{text-decoration:none;}
#dm img{border:none;}
/*=Fotogalerie===================================================*/
#e{width:100%;background:#f5deb3;border-top:1px solid black;font-size:0.8em;}
#e-left{width:100%;float:left;}
#e-left-content{width:auto;margin:0.7em 0.7em 0.7em 0.7em;border-left:1px solid black;padding:0.7em 0.7em 0.7em 0.7em;text-align:center;}
#e img{border:none;}
/*=Tělo webu 3loupce======================================================*/
#f{width:100%;background:#f5deb3;border-top:1px solid black;font-size:0.8em;}
#f-left{width:35%;float:left;}
#f-left-content{width:auto;margin:0.7em 0.7em 0.7em 0.7em;border-left:1px solid black;padding:0.7em 0.7em 0.7em 0.7em;text-align:left;}
#f-center{width:34%;float:left;}
#f-center-content{width:auto;margin:0.7em 0.7em 0.7em 0.7em;border-left:1px solid black;padding:0.7em 0.7em 0.7em 0.7em;text-align:left;}
#f-right{width:26%;float:right;}
#f-right-content{width:auto;margin:0.7em 0.7em 0.7em 0.7em;padding:0.7em 0.7em 0.7em 0.7em;text-align:left;}
/*=*/
#f img{border:none;}
#f h3{background:transparent;color:blue;font-size:1.1em;}
#f h4{font-size:1em;}
#f hr{width:100%;height:1px;background:transparent;color:black;}
/*=Tělo webu 2sloupce=================================================================*/
#g{width:100%;background:#f5deb3;border-top:1px solid black;font-size:0.8em;}
#g-left{width:60%;float:left;}
#g-left-content{width:auto;margin:0.7em 0.7em 0.7em 0.7em;border-left:1px solid black;padding:0.7em 0.7em 0.7em 0.7em;text-align:left;}
#g-right{width:40%;float:right;}
#g-right-content{width:auto;margin:0.7em 0.7em 0.7em 0.7em;padding:0.7em 0.7em 0.7em 0.7em;text-align:left;}
/*=*/
#g img{border:none;}
#g h3{background:transparent;color:blue;font-size:1.1em;}
#g h4{font-size:1em;}
#g hr{width:100%;height:1px;background:transparent;color:black;}
/*=Uvodní text na indexu=================================================================*/
#h{width:100%;background:#f5deb3;border-top:1px solid black;}
#h-left{width:100%;float:left;}
#h-left-content{width:auto;margin:0.7em 0.7em 0.7em 0.7em;border-left:1px solid black;padding:0.7em 0.7em 0.7em 0.7em;font-size:0.8em;text-align:left;}
/*=Detail základní box======================================================*/
.box1{width:100%;float:left;}
.box1-content{
width:auto;
text-align:left;
font-weight:bold;
border-top: 1px solid black;
padding:0.7em 0 0.7em 0em;
}
/*=Detail box s obrázky======================================================*/
.box2{width:93%;float:right;}
.box2-content{
width:auto;
background:white url(images/bg-box2.jpg) top center repeat-y;
text-align:center;
border: 1px solid black;
padding:7px;
}
/*=Detail box s pozadím======================================================*/
.box3{width:93%;float:right;}
.box3-content{
width:auto;
background:white url(images/bg-box43.jpg) center center repeat-y;
border: 1px solid black;
text-align:center;
margin:0 0 0.7em 0;
padding:0.7em 0 0.7em 0;
}
/*=Web box s obrázky======================================================*/
.box3m{width:93%;float:right;}
.box3m-content{
width:auto;
background:white url(images/bg-box2.jpg) center center repeat-y;
font-size:0.9em;
text-align:center;
margin:0 0 0.7em 0;
border: 1px solid black;
padding:0.7em 0 0.7em 0;
}
/*=Web box s pozadím======================================================*/
.box5{width:100%;float:left;}
.box5-content{
width:auto;
background:white url(images/bg-box43.jpg) top center repeat-y;
font-size:0.9em;
text-align:center;
margin:0 0.7em 0.7em 0.7em;
border: 1px solid black;
padding:0.7em 0.7em 0.7em 0.7em;
}
.box5 a{text-decoration:underline}
/*==================================================================*/
/* denni menu */
#dennimenu{font-family:monospace;margin:0% 20%;font-size:medium;}
#dennimenu p{text-align:center;}
/* tabulka s mapou na stránce mapa.php */
#mapa{
background:#f5deb3;
border-collapse:collapse;
text-align:center;
border:groove;
width:100%;
}
#mapa a{
text-decoration:none;
}
.sqlecho{font-size:medium;}
.jlistek-popisjidla{color:gray;font-style:italic;}
.otevreno{color:green;}
.zavreno{color:#cc3300;}
